What it's like to live in Mount Vernon?
The Local Vibe (Location & Identity)
Mount Vernon serves as the historic county seat of Franklin County, situated approximately 100 miles east of the Dallas-Fort Worth metroplex along Interstate 30. With a population of roughly 2,700 residents, the city functions as a standalone rural hub rather than a suburban bedroom community. The local economy is supported by the Lowe’s Distribution Center and regional agricultural operations, creating a stable environment for a mix of established families and retirees drawn to the area's natural pace.
Living Here: Amenities & Lifestyle
Daily life in Mount Vernon centers on the picturesque downtown square, where residents visit the Franklin County Historical Association museums or shop at local boutiques. Weekends often involve trips to Little Creek Park for community events or a short drive south to the shores of Lake Cypress Springs for boating and fishing. While the city maintains a quiet atmosphere, the I-30 corridor provides a direct route for those commuting to Mount Pleasant or Sulphur Springs for expanded retail and healthcare options. Residents enjoy a lifestyle defined by wide-open spaces and a slower daily rhythm. Schools & Family Appeal
Families are served by the Mount Vernon Independent School District, which acts as a central pillar of the community. The district’s campuses are known for strong local engagement and a focus on both academic achievement and extracurricular participation. This community-centric approach to education, combined with the safety of a small-town environment, remains a primary driver for families relocating to the area.
Why New Construction Makes Sense Here
Choosing new construction in Mount Vernon offers significant peace of mind, particularly given the humid subtropical climate of Northeast Texas. Older homes in the region often require immediate capital expenditures for foundation stabilization or roof repairs due to local soil conditions and weather patterns. A new build provides a 10-year structural warranty and modern HVAC systems designed for high-efficiency cooling during sweltering Texas summers.
